Sonar-tools

Latest version: v3.6

Safety actively analyzes 682457 Python packages for vulnerabilities to keep your Python projects secure.

Scan your dependencies

Page 1 of 10

3.6

* Numerous hardening and improvemenst on `sonar-audit`, `sonar-measures-export`, `sonar-findings-sync`, `sonar-config`
See https://github.com/okorach/sonar-tools/milestone/40?closed=1
* Added documentation of `sonar-rules`

What's Changed
* Update 3.5 docs by okorach in https://github.com/okorach/sonar-tools/pull/1420
* Own UA for each tool by okorach in https://github.com/okorach/sonar-tools/pull/1422
* Mutualize migration and config by okorach in https://github.com/okorach/sonar-tools/pull/1423
* Fix Python 3.8 dependency by okorach in https://github.com/okorach/sonar-tools/pull/1425
* Clean impacts implementation in findings-export by okorach in https://github.com/okorach/sonar-tools/pull/1427
* Guess lang of external rules when missing by okorach in https://github.com/okorach/sonar-tools/pull/1430
* Fix random order of metrics when using -m _all by okorach in https://github.com/okorach/sonar-tools/pull/1431
* Fix-regression-on-issues by okorach in https://github.com/okorach/sonar-tools/pull/1435
* Fix findings test to take into account MQR by okorach in https://github.com/okorach/sonar-tools/pull/1436
* Header for sonar-rules CSV by okorach in https://github.com/okorach/sonar-tools/pull/1437
* Audit analysis warnings on branches 776 by okorach in https://github.com/okorach/sonar-tools/pull/1439
* Add dart and jupyter as standard language settings by okorach in https://github.com/okorach/sonar-tools/pull/1441
* Import hardening 1 by okorach in https://github.com/okorach/sonar-tools/pull/1446
* Import hardening portfolios by okorach in https://github.com/okorach/sonar-tools/pull/1452
* sonar-config import hardening by okorach in https://github.com/okorach/sonar-tools/pull/1455
* Hardening from tests by okorach in https://github.com/okorach/sonar-tools/pull/1459
* Abstract cache implementation by okorach in https://github.com/okorach/sonar-tools/pull/1460
* Findings sync hardening by okorach in https://github.com/okorach/sonar-tools/pull/1463
* Exception handler by okorach in https://github.com/okorach/sonar-tools/pull/1465
* Fix speed of SC/SQ rule/QP export by okorach in https://github.com/okorach/sonar-tools/pull/1467
* Fix 10000 rules limit by okorach in https://github.com/okorach/sonar-tools/pull/1470
* MQR rules and legacy severity by okorach in https://github.com/okorach/sonar-tools/pull/1472
* Adjust tests on rules and findings for 9.9 by okorach in https://github.com/okorach/sonar-tools/pull/1473
* Fixes 1222 by okorach in https://github.com/okorach/sonar-tools/pull/1474
* Maintenance October 2024 by okorach in https://github.com/okorach/sonar-tools/pull/1476
* json data as public SQ object attribute by okorach in https://github.com/okorach/sonar-tools/pull/1477
* Fixes 1478 + Audit refactoring for conciseness by okorach in https://github.com/okorach/sonar-tools/pull/1479
* Simplify export and audit by okorach in https://github.com/okorach/sonar-tools/pull/1480
* Adjust-tests by okorach in https://github.com/okorach/sonar-tools/pull/1481
* Update 3.6 by okorach in https://github.com/okorach/sonar-tools/pull/1482


**Full Changelog**: https://github.com/okorach/sonar-tools/compare/3.5...3.6

3.5

What's Changed
* Many performance improvements
* `sonar-audit` improvements
* Output audit problems on the fly 1395
* Several fixes:
* 1417
* 1415
* 1411
* 1386
* `sonar-config` fix 1326
* Include **dart** and **ipython** as built-in languages since they were introduced in SonarQube 10.7
* Display HTTP requests durations in logs

**Full Changelog**: https://github.com/okorach/sonar-tools/compare/3.4...3.5

3.4.2

What's Changed

2 hot fixes:
In 3.4.2 - 1386
In 3.4.1 - 1358
**Full Changelog**: https://github.com/okorach/sonar-tools/compare/3.4.1..3.4.2

3.4

What's Changed

- `sonar-tools` is now also shipped as a docker image. See https://github.com/okorach/sonar-tools?tab=readme-ov-file#docker on how to use `sonar-tools` in docker
- `sonar-config` can now export configuration in YAML format. Import of YAML format is not yet supported
- `sonar-config` can now import configuration in SonarCloud (experimental alpha version)
- Several fixes

Details
* Bump version to 3.4 by okorach in https://github.com/okorach/sonar-tools/pull/1261
* Add docker image by okorach in https://github.com/okorach/sonar-tools/pull/1263
* Handle file write access denied by okorach in https://github.com/okorach/sonar-tools/pull/1269
* Add SonarQube URL in sonar-config export by okorach in https://github.com/okorach/sonar-tools/pull/1270
* Check inputs files and raise clean errors when can't read by okorach in https://github.com/okorach/sonar-tools/pull/1272
* Remove calls to deprecated user and group APIs by okorach in https://github.com/okorach/sonar-tools/pull/1274
* Simplify output format selection by okorach in https://github.com/okorach/sonar-tools/pull/1276
* More consistent projects export/import CLI by okorach in https://github.com/okorach/sonar-tools/pull/1278
* Allows JSON and CSV export formats by okorach in https://github.com/okorach/sonar-tools/pull/1279
* Fixes by okorach in https://github.com/okorach/sonar-tools/pull/1280
* Gracefully handle HTTP errors in threads by okorach in https://github.com/okorach/sonar-tools/pull/1281
* YAML sonar-config export beta by okorach in https://github.com/okorach/sonar-tools/pull/1282
* Improve YAML output by okorach in https://github.com/okorach/sonar-tools/pull/1289
* Config import sonarcloud alpha by okorach in https://github.com/okorach/sonar-tools/pull/1291
* Fix 1286 by okorach in https://github.com/okorach/sonar-tools/pull/1293
* Fixes 1287 by okorach in https://github.com/okorach/sonar-tools/pull/1294
* Fix 1288 by okorach in https://github.com/okorach/sonar-tools/pull/1295
* Fixes 1301 by okorach in https://github.com/okorach/sonar-tools/pull/1302
* Fixes 1303 by okorach in https://github.com/okorach/sonar-tools/pull/1319
* Exclude migration tool from coverage & duplication by okorach in https://github.com/okorach/sonar-tools/pull/1321
* Add-basic-sonar-migration-test by okorach in https://github.com/okorach/sonar-tools/pull/1322


**Full Changelog**: https://github.com/okorach/sonar-tools/compare/3.3...3.4

3.3

- `sonar-config`: Improved / Hardened several elements for both import and export
- Fixed portfolios import/export
- Fixed permissions import (for projects, applications and portfolios)
- Better compatibility with SonarCloud
- Other misc bug fixes
- `sonar-audit`: Added verification that projects are analyzed with the right scanner (Maven, Gradle, .Net). This verification is not 100% reliable

What's Changed
* Fixes findings and measures export by okorach in https://github.com/okorach/sonar-tools/pull/1200
* Fixes for release 3.2.1 by okorach in https://github.com/okorach/sonar-tools/pull/1201
* Compatibility CE and CE 10.x and 9.9 by okorach in https://github.com/okorach/sonar-tools/pull/1207
* Compatibility with CE and DE both for LTS/LTA and LATEST by okorach in https://github.com/okorach/sonar-tools/pull/1208
* bump version by okorach in https://github.com/okorach/sonar-tools/pull/1209
* Update what's new by okorach in https://github.com/okorach/sonar-tools/pull/1211
* Detect usage of incorrect scanner by okorach in https://github.com/okorach/sonar-tools/pull/1212
* Custom types for better type hints by okorach in https://github.com/okorach/sonar-tools/pull/1214
* Add KeyList type by okorach in https://github.com/okorach/sonar-tools/pull/1215
* Audit 3rd party plugins by okorach in https://github.com/okorach/sonar-tools/pull/1216
* Refactoring search-object by okorach in https://github.com/okorach/sonar-tools/pull/1219
* Refactoring-audit-problem by okorach in https://github.com/okorach/sonar-tools/pull/1220
* Hardening sonar-config import by okorach in https://github.com/okorach/sonar-tools/pull/1224
* Fix-sonar-config-import by okorach in https://github.com/okorach/sonar-tools/pull/1229
* sonar-config fixes by okorach in https://github.com/okorach/sonar-tools/pull/1231
* Fix-lamguage-existence by okorach in https://github.com/okorach/sonar-tools/pull/1232
* Further-sonar-config-hardening by okorach in https://github.com/okorach/sonar-tools/pull/1234
* Further sonar config hardening by okorach in https://github.com/okorach/sonar-tools/pull/1235
* GL URL format by okorach in https://github.com/okorach/sonar-tools/pull/1236
* Fix import portfolios by okorach in https://github.com/okorach/sonar-tools/pull/1239
* Portfolios-export-import fix export by okorach in https://github.com/okorach/sonar-tools/pull/1242
* Improve portfolio export by okorach in https://github.com/okorach/sonar-tools/pull/1243
* Cast the timeout parameter to int by toliger in https://github.com/okorach/sonar-tools/pull/1246
* Improve portfolio import by okorach in https://github.com/okorach/sonar-tools/pull/1245
* Streamline-portfolios-json by okorach in https://github.com/okorach/sonar-tools/pull/1247
* Fix 1248 by okorach in https://github.com/okorach/sonar-tools/pull/1249
* Add-applications-in-portfolios-export by okorach in https://github.com/okorach/sonar-tools/pull/1252
* Add-applications-in-portfolio-import by okorach in https://github.com/okorach/sonar-tools/pull/1253
* Fix devops export by okorach in https://github.com/okorach/sonar-tools/pull/1255
* Fix sonarcloud project config settings export by okorach in https://github.com/okorach/sonar-tools/pull/1256
* Fix usage with SonarCloud by okorach in https://github.com/okorach/sonar-tools/pull/1259

New Contributors
* toliger made their first contribution in https://github.com/okorach/sonar-tools/pull/1246

**Full Changelog**: https://github.com/okorach/sonar-tools/compare/3.2...3.3

3.2.1

- Patch release to fix all compatibility problems with
- Lower editions: All editions (Community, Developer, Enterprise) have been tested
- 9.9 LTS/LTA version: All editions (Community, Developer, Enterprise) in version 9.9 have been tested

What's Changed
* Fixes findings and measures export by okorach in https://github.com/okorach/sonar-tools/pull/1200
* Fixes for release 3.2.1 by okorach in https://github.com/okorach/sonar-tools/pull/1201
* Compatibility CE and CE 10.x and 9.9 by okorach in https://github.com/okorach/sonar-tools/pull/1207
* Update what's new by okorach in https://github.com/okorach/sonar-tools/pull/1211


**Full Changelog**: https://github.com/okorach/sonar-tools/compare/3.2...3.2.1

Page 1 of 10

© 2024 Safety CLI Cybersecurity Inc. All Rights Reserved.